What is an American Fridge Freezer?

An American fridge freezer usually refers to a side-by-side or French door fridge that offers ample storage space and a variety of features that deal with modern-day culinary requirements. These appliances are developed with the convenience of availability in mind, making it easy for users to keep food and beverages.

Popular Features of American Fridge Freezers

American fridge freezers include a selection of features that boost their functionality and benefit. Some common features consist of:

  • Twin Cooling System: Maintains maximum humidity for both the fridge and freezer compartments, preventing smell transfer.
  • Water and Ice Dispenser: Supplying filtered water and crushed or cubed ice.
  • Adjustable Shelving: Allowing for personalization of storage area to accommodate large products.
  • Smart Technology: Enabling remote availability and temperature level control through smartphone apps.

Benefits of American Fridge Freezers

  1. Large Capacity: With a typical capability of 20 to 28 cubic feet, American fridge freezers can hold large amounts of food. This is especially advantageous for bigger families or those who like to stockpile on groceries.

  2. Availability: Side-by-side and French door styles enable easy access to both the refrigerator and freezer sections without the requirement to open multiple doors.

  3. Versatile Storage Options: Many designs consist of adjustable shelves, crisper drawers, and door bins, making company basic and efficient.

  4. Advanced Features: From wise innovation to humidity controls, American fridge freezers often come geared up with contemporary features that improve user convenience.

Factors to consider Before Buying

While American fridge freezers use a plethora of advantages, customers should think about the list below elements prior to buying:

  • Size: Ensure your kitchen area can accommodate the dimensions of the fridge freezer.
  • Energy Efficiency: Look for systems with Energy Star scores to reduce energy intake and decrease utility costs.
  • Cost: Prices for these appliances vary extensively. Setting a budget plan in advance assists narrow alternatives.
  • Maintenance: Some features may require more maintenance than others. It's vital to understand the care requirements for any design being thought about.

Frequently asked question Section

1. What is the difference in between a French door and a side-by-side fridge?

Answer: French door refrigerators have 2 doors for the fridge area and a separate bottom-mounted freezer drawer. Side-by-side units include a vertical split with the fridge on one side and the freezer on the other. French door designs generally provide more fridge area, while side-by-sides supply equal access to both compartments.

2. Are American fridge freezers energy-efficient?

Answer: Yes, numerous American fridge freezers feature Energy Star ratings, suggesting that they fulfill energy efficiency guidelines set by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ency. Customers can conserve cash on energy bills by choosing designs with lower energy intake.

3. How often should I clean and preserve my fridge freezer?

Response: It is advised to clean up the interior of your fridge freezer every 3 to 6 months and to clean the condenser coils every 6 months. Routine maintenance helps to enhance performance and prolong the home appliance's life expectancy.

4. How do I pick the right size fridge freezer for my kitchen?

Answer: Measure the area where you prepare to put the fridge freezer and consider your home size and cooking habits. A general standard is 4-6 cubic feet per person in the home.

5. Are there warranties available for American fridge freezers?

Answer: Yes, a lot of American fridge freezer producers provide service warranties that cover parts and labor for a specific duration. It's crucial to review the guarantee details before acquiring to understand what is covered.
